Description

Stepped setting inflatable packer
Technical field
This utility model relates to a kind of packer, refers in particular to a kind of stepped setting inflatable packer.
Background technology
Packer means have elastic sealing elements, and annular space between packing various sizes tubing string and well and between tubing string whereby, and completely cuts off payzone, to control to produce (note) liquid, protects the downhole tool of sleeve pipe. Because the packer quantity installed in drill string is more, fracturing fluid can make packer all set when injecting, so just the packer premature setting in top portion is caused, annular space balance pressure can not balance the operting differential pressure of lower packer, the packer causing bottom lost efficacy because differential pressure is too high, also produced unnecessary consume simultaneously. The patent No. is the Chinese patent " stepped setting fracture packer " of 201120489411, its technical scheme is: throws steel ball in central canal and is seated on ball seat, water filling is suppressed to cut off and is set shear pin, sliding sleeve and ball seat connect descending by fixture block, open the inlet opening at adapter sleeve place, when sliding sleeve goes downwards to lower contact endoporus shoulder place, rise outside fixture block, packer feed pathway is opened, when intrinsic pressure higher than external pressure 2Mpa time packer setting. Wherein ball seat is descending together with steel ball, and steel ball is arranged on ball seat all the time, it is easy to results in blockage, brings inconvenience to use procedure.
Utility model content
This utility model provides a kind of stepped setting inflatable packer, can not the problem of stepped setting it is intended that solve packer.
Stepped setting inflatable packer, including central canal, it is connected to top connection and the lower contact at central canal two ends, distensible packing element, it is sheathed on upper jacket and the lower jacket at the upper and lower two ends of packing element, and it is located at the cylinder sleeve below lower jacket, also include the distensible elastic base being installed in central canal and the steel ball coordinated with this elastic base; The sidewall of described lower contact offers shear pin hole, shear pin hole is equipped with the shear pin for fixing elastic base, inside described lower jacket, be provided with the shoulder for preventing elastic base from falling.
Wherein, described elastic base upper end circumferentially has several elongated slot equably so that several elastic claw is formed at top.
Wherein, the sidewall of described lower contact offering some inlet openings, this inlet opening and shear pin hole are positioned on the same circumference of lower contact.
Wherein, the both sides up and down in described shear pin hole are equipped with sealing ring.
Wherein, being provided with filter screen outside described elastic base, when elastic base is stuck on shoulder, this filter screen is connected with inlet opening and shear pin hole.
Wherein, described cylinder sleeve lower end is provided with baffle ring, and this baffle ring is fixed on outside lower contact.
Use packer described in the utility model, it may be achieved multiple packers insulate from the bottom up step by step, make the packer setting of correspondence, and set during other packer differences of upper strata. Adopting elastic base in this product, can pass through elastic steel ball can depart from from elastic base, it is prevented that blocking. Meanwhile, outside elastic base, it is provided with filter screen, thus preventing fracturing sand from entering inlet opening, it is prevented that inlet opening blocks. It addition, by baffle ring be designed to prevent from cylinder sleeve to be axially moveable making packing element shrink.

Detailed description of the invention
Detailed description of the invention of the present utility model is as follows:
A kind of stepped setting inflatable packer, with reference to Fig. 1, Fig. 2, Fig. 3 and Fig. 4, the respectively top connection 1 of the two ends up and down of central canal 4 and lower contact 11, central canal 4 outer sheath is provided with packing element 3, and this packing element 3 can expand outwardly after the pressurizing. The two ends up and down of packing element 3 are arranged with upper jacket 2 and lower jacket 5 respectively, wherein lower jacket 5 be connected with cylinder sleeve 6, this cylinder sleeve 6 is positioned at outside lower contact 11. Being provided with an elastic base 10 in central canal 4, elastic base 10 upper end circumferentially has several elongated slot equably so that several elastic claw 100 is formed at top. Elastic claw 100 is gathered to be contracted in and is formed for ball seat together afterwards, is used for accepting steel ball 7, can automatically restore to free state after removing constraint under elastic force, makes steel ball 7 drop. It is provided with shoulder 110 inside lower contact 11, is stuck in after elastic base 10 is descending on this shoulder 110. The sidewall of described lower contact 11 offers 4 inlet openings 13 and 2 shear pin holes 14 along same circumference, elastic base 10 and lower contact 11 are fixed by the shear pin 9 in shear pin hole 14, the both sides up and down of inlet opening 13 are equipped with sealing ring 15, it is prevented that when not setting, fracturing fluid flows out from shear pin hole 14 and inlet opening 13. Being provided with filter screen 8 outside elastic base 10, when elastic base 10 is descending, filter screen 8 is connected with inlet opening 13 and shear pin hole 14, it is prevented that fracturing sand enters inlet opening 13 and shear pin hole 14, results in blockage. Cylinder sleeve 6 lower end is provided with a circle and is fixed on the baffle ring 12 outside lower contact 11, can be used for preventing cylinder sleeve 6 from being produced mobile by the extruding of lower attachment, thus preventing packing element 3 to be squeezed.
Being installed in String by multiple packers described in the utility model, wherein the aperture of elastic base 10 increases from lower to upper successively, and the diameter of each steel ball 7 of input also increases successively. First steel ball 7 diameter put into is more than elastic base 10 aperture of bottom packer, less than elastic base 10 aperture of other packers of top. Steel ball 7 puts in central canal 4 and falls within elastic base 10, water filling is suppressed to cut off and is set shear pin 9, elastic base 10 is descending, fracturing fluid inlet opening 13 in lower contact 11 and shear pin hole 14 flow into lower contact 11 and the annular clearance of cylinder sleeve 6, gap again through central canal 4 and packing element 3, hydraulic pressure struts packing element, it is achieved set.Ball seat resilience under natural resiliency power effect that the elastic claw 100 of elastic base 10 is formed. It is descending that steel ball 7 departs from elastic base 10. Put into steel ball 7 successively, make packer stepped setting from lower to upper.
